Seven Steps to Success 1) Make a commitment to grow daily. 2) Value the process more than events. 3) Don’t wait for inspiration. 4) Be willing to sacrifice pleasure for opportunity. 5) Dream big. 6) Plan your priorities. 7) Give up to go up.
JOHN C. MAXWELLFailing forward is the ability to get back up after you’ve been knocked down, learn from your mistake, and move forward in a better direction.
